I think it might be easier and maybe more helpful down the line to make or buy some the 30166 waveguide adapters and keep them stock with a 1.4" throat and then just use a 1" to 1.4" metal adapter.
You might want 288's with tangerine phase plugs down the line as they can get up there and you might be able to squeak by without a super tweeter so I personally would not limit myself by making a 1" only waveguide.

HI,
I looked at in AutoCad and I see sections where the curve goes negative. These are the wobbles in your plot. In my experience with smaller horns a constant radius will fit to the expansion within tolerances anyone is likely to hold during construction. I don't know if that holds true for these big boys but measuring a curve from the outside of the horn should be easier. All you need is a straight board with a center mark and a ruler.
BTW, if you need them I can make printable templates and email them to you but we will need to get the curve plotted accurately first.
